A new controversy has occurred as the social media influencer Orhan Awatramani, popularly known as Orry, along with seven others, were booked for consuming alcohol at a hotel in Katra, the base camp for the sacred Mata Vaishno Devi temple, by the Jammu and Kashmir Police.
Russian national, Anastasila Arzamaskina, is among the eight individuals involved in the matter, according to sources from Republic.
An FIR (No. 72/25) has been filed at Katra Police Station against Orhan Awatramani (Orry), Darshan Singh, Parth Raina, Ritick Singh, Rashi Dutta, Rakshita Bhogal, Shagun Kohli, and Anastasila Arzamaskina for violating a District Magistrate’s order and for offending religious sentiments. The charges are filed under Section 223 of the Bharatiya Nyaya Sanhita (BNS).
